QuoteOriginally posted by Aaron28 Quote
mamiya/sekor 500 dtl…...flithy, gritty from mobile, alabama…..took some good coaxing but seems to run smooth now.....light meter does not function....cleaned up decently
The meter circuits on the 1000 and 500 DTL cameras are notorious for failing due to battery corrosion wicking up the wiring. I had my 1000 DTL fixed by Camera Solutions in Portland, OR. At that time, they had a tech who was Mamiya factory trained in Japan in the late 60s. Perhaps he is still there.

QuoteOriginally posted by disconnekt Quote
Well, due to everyone here being a bad influence and that there was a recent post talking about ebay's "make an offer" option, I happened to find a Ricoh Rikenon XR 35mm f2.8 monday night that some had just listed with a "to buy" option for $37 and a "make offer" option, so I made an offer of $25 which they accepted on tuesday morning, so now it'll be here in a few days.
Good find! The XR Rikenon 35/2.8 is widely considered to be evil twin to the Pentax-M 35/2.8. The two are identical except for the beauty ring and perhaps coatings; both are excellent.
